Tottenham Hotspur defender Micky van de Ven has endured a ‘stop-start’ campaign at N17. The Netherlands international has quickly become a fan favourite at the club and Ange Postecoglou relies on the centre-back heavily. However, this season has not been the best for the talented defender due to several injury issues that have forced him to be on the sidelines for most parts of the campaign.

The ex-Wolfsburg player arrived at North London with high hopes and quickly became one of the first names on the team-sheet under Big Ange. But the Spurs manager has been forced to field a starting eleven without Van de Ven at the back for crucial games this season. But much to the delight of the fans, the Spurs No.37 is fit again and ready to make an impact in the last part of the campaign.

Micky van de Ven is hoping to end the season on a positive note after a disastrous domestic campaign.

The Lilywhites have managed to reach the Europa League final this season. They will face Manchester United for the trophy as Ange’s men have the chance of ending the club’s long-standing trophy drought. It would be a historic achievement if this squad manages to bring European silverware back to N17 after enduring a disastrous domestic campaign.

Micky van de Ven hopes to win the Europa League final

Tottenham Hotspur fans will hope that the players step up in the upcoming final against Manchester United. Ange’s men have already beaten the Red Devils thrice this season in all competitions, so recent history suggests that it should be a straightforward win for the Lilywhites. But Ruben Amorim’s side are unbeaten in Europe this season, and have the capacity to turn up in big moments and cause an upset.

Tottenham star Micky van de Ven is aiming to win the Europa League this year.

When asked about his aims for the Europa League final, Micky van de Ven told British GQ magazine,

“If you join Spurs, of course people make jokes that you’re never going to win a trophy. This group of players and staff want to make sure we change this for the fans and the club. We’ve had a really tough season, so we want to end positively – for us, and for the fans for how they have supported us this season.”

Micky van de Ven has suggested that the squad is aiming to silence all the critics this season and put an end to the endless trolling of Tottenham not winning a trophy. The Dutch centre-back has also acknowledged that it has been a tough season for the Lilywhites and they are aiming to end the campaign on a high by winning the Europa League.
